What Is AEO and Why Should CPA Firms in Eastmark Care?
AEO — Answer Engine Optimization — is the practice of structuring your website’s content so that AI-powered tools like Google’s AI Overviews, Bing Copilot, and voice assistants can confidently pull your firm’s information as a direct answer to a user’s question. Traditional SEO gets you on a results page. AEO gets you above the results page, in the answer box, or read aloud to someone driving home from work asking, “Who’s the best CPA near Eastmark Mesa?”
For accounting firms, this matters for a specific reason: the questions people ask about CPAs are highly answerable. “What does a CPA charge for tax preparation in Mesa?” “Can a CPA help me set up an LLC in Arizona?” “When is the Arizona state tax deadline?” These are exactly the kinds of queries AEO is built to win. If your content answers them clearly, completely, and in the format search engines prefer, your firm earns the citation — and the credibility that comes with it.

The Core Elements of AEO for Accounting Firms
Winning answer positions isn’t about stuffing keywords. It requires a deliberate content architecture that signals expertise, authority, and trustworthiness to both AI systems and the humans who eventually click through.
Structured FAQ Content
The single fastest AEO win for most CPA firms is adding well-written FAQ sections to key service pages — and marking them up with FAQ schema. When Google’s crawler sees a question paired with a clean, direct answer and proper schema markup, it has everything it needs to surface that content in an AI Overview or featured snippet. Questions like “What is the deadline to file an Arizona state tax return?” or “Do I need a CPA or just an accountant?” are low-competition, high-intent queries your firm can realistically own.
Entity-Based Content and Local Signals
AI engines don’t just match keywords — they identify entities. Your firm needs to be established as a recognized entity: consistent NAP (name, address, phone) across Google Business Profile, Yelp, and local directories; clear on-page signals that you serve Eastmark, Mesa, and the East Valley; and content that references real local context (Arizona’s community property tax treatment, Maricopa County filing requirements, and so on). These signals tell AI systems that your firm is a legitimate, local authority — not a generic national listing.
Conversational, Question-Led Page Structure
Pages built for AEO lead with the question, answer it in the first one or two sentences, and then expand. This mirrors exactly how AI engines parse and summarize content. If your service pages open with a wall of marketing copy about how “our experienced team is dedicated to excellence,” an AI has nothing to cite. Rewriting those pages with a direct, question-led format is one of the highest-ROI moves a CPA firm can make right now.
AEO vs. Traditional SEO: What’s the Real Difference for Your Mesa Practice?
Traditional SEO is about ranking on page one. AEO is about being the answer — the sentence or paragraph that appears before page one even loads. Both matter, but they require different content strategies. An SEO-optimized page is built to rank for a keyword. An AEO-optimized page is built to be cited by an AI summarizing an answer.
For CPA firms in a competitive East Valley market, the smartest approach layers both. Your core service pages — tax preparation, bookkeeping, business advisory — should rank well in organic search. Your FAQ content and locally-relevant explainers should be structured for AEO. Done together, they create a presence that captures traffic at every stage: the person browsing options, the person asking a quick voice query, and the person who’s ready to call right now.

Frequently Asked Questions: AEO for CPA Firms in Eastmark, Mesa, Arizona
What is AEO and how is it different from SEO for CPA firms?
AEO (Answer Engine Optimization) structures your content so AI systems and voice search tools can cite your firm as the direct answer to a user’s question. Traditional SEO helps you rank on the search results page. AEO puts you above the results, in the answer box or AI Overview — which is especially valuable for CPA firms because accounting questions are highly answerable and frequently searched.
How long does it take for AEO changes to show results for a Mesa CPA firm?
Most firms begin seeing early AEO wins — featured snippets, FAQ result appearances, or AI Overview citations — within six to twelve weeks of implementing structured content and schema markup. Broader authority signals and competitive queries can take three to six months to fully reflect in AI-driven results.
Do I need to be a large firm to benefit from AEO in Eastmark?
No. Solo practitioners and small CPA firms often have an easier time achieving AEO wins than large national firms, because local answer queries are less competitive. A two-person firm in Eastmark that answers “What does a CPA charge for tax prep in Mesa, Arizona?” clearly and concisely can absolutely claim that answer position over a generic national directory.
What types of questions should my CPA firm’s content answer for AEO?
Focus on questions your prospective clients actually ask: Arizona-specific tax deadlines, the difference between a CPA and a bookkeeper, when to hire a CPA for a small business, community property rules in Arizona, and what to bring to a first tax appointment. These are direct, answerable questions that AI engines love to cite from authoritative local sources.
Is Google Business Profile optimization part of AEO?
Yes. A complete, accurate, and consistently updated Google Business Profile is a core entity signal for AI-driven search. For CPA firms in Eastmark and Mesa, it also drives local pack rankings and direct calls from Maps. AEO and GBP optimization work together — one reinforces the other.
